Position Summary:
The Marion County Prosecutor’s Office seeks attorneys dedicated to public service, public safety, and fairness and justice for all who interact with the child support system.
Deputy Prosecutors carry a diverse caseload and appear on behalf of the State of Indiana in all IV-D matters in the Marion County Civil Court proceedings and Federal District Court Bankruptcy proceedings.
An entry-level Deputy Prosecutor is assigned to either an establishment or enforcement position in the Child Support Division.
Essential Job Functions:
Managing a large caseload, covering the full range of establishment, modification, and enforcement functions.
Mastering important related subjects, including administrative law, bankruptcy, liens, probate, contract, forfeiture, and interstate laws to ensure appropriate actions are taken as needed.
Drafting special pleadings and documents as needed.
Mastering the application of the Indiana Child Support Guidelines to determine appropriate, recommended child support orders in a fair and accurate manner.
Understanding applicable rules, laws, and guidelines, including the Indiana Rules of Civil Procedure,
Indiana Rules of Trial Procedure and Rules of Professional Conduct.
Mastering the statewide child support computer system and other applications needed to fully perform establishment, modification, and enforcement functions.
Participating in various community events or meetings to meet and educate the public on the role of the
Child Support Division of the Marion County Prosecutor’s Office and address individual questions or concerns when possible.
Agency Expectations:
Follow the Marion County Prosecutor’s personnel policies, particularly regarding confidentiality, sexual harassment, and usage of information technology resources.
Maintain respectful and professional behavior and communication with the public, judicial, and law enforcement personnel, and office staff.
Complete work assignments and communicate with participants and IV-D agencies in a timely, accurate, and efficient manner.
Attend training as directed.
Other related duties as assigned.
